Leven station is all about functionality and ease of access. While it may lack some of the larger amenities found at major stations, it makes up for it with its simplicity and accessibility. Don’t expect a ticket office or fancy waiting rooms here—it’s about straightforward service. Although there isn't a ticket machine, you can still collect pre-purchased tickets through designated machines that are accessible and friendly to all.
The station ensures inclusivity with step-free access making it a Category A station, offering easy mobility throughout. While you'll need to rely on your phone or other devices for entertainment as there is no public Wi-Fi or waiting rooms, a seating area is available to relax while you wait for your train.
Getting to and from Leven train station is effortless with a range of onward travel options. Taxis are available, and you can plan your ride by visiting www.traintaxi.co.uk. For those times when rail services are not available, a rail replacement service operates with easy access at the lay-by in front of the station. Local bus services are also a viable option for exploring nearby attractions and towns.

Whitchurch station is equipped with essential amenities to facilitate a smooth journey. Although there is no ticket office, you’ll find a ticket machine where you can collect tickets bought online using a major debit or credit card. For those requiring assistance, there are help points available, and information screens provide details of departure and arrival times.
Accessibility is a key feature at the station with step-free access available on Platform 2, which services routes to Crewe. For traveling to Shrewsbury on Platform 1, note that access is via a footbridge with 44 steps. Passenger assist services are available with requests being required at least two hours before departure.
The station has 31 parking spaces available 24/7, along with dedicated accessible parking spots. Though lacking in refreshment shops and waiting lounges, the station still maintains a friendly environment with seating areas present.
When it comes to continuing your journey from Whitchurch, you’ll find convenient transport links right by the station. A rail replacement bus service operates, collecting passengers from nearby Station Road. Although there are no bicycle hire facilities, cycling enthusiasts can make use of the six bicycle stands available on the Crewe-bound platform. While taxis and car hire services aren't specified at the station, local options within Whitchurch are readily available for hire if needed.
